Output 21ea16d67b8d5ae416e3a66e5a47fdbf57dabd31e76e1533fd6163314ff8a3c1:0

value
3140367
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c5778c27901cc1ad034e40f3797803238f2e6edcd4b51fad3c7d72842e6ac25e
address
bc1pc4mccfusrnq66q6wgrehj7qryw8jumku6j63ltfu04eggtn2cf0qzmdrej
transaction
21ea16d67b8d5ae416e3a66e5a47fdbf57dabd31e76e1533fd6163314ff8a3c1
spent
true